Fun Factory USA Names Michael Cox Senior Sales Manager

LOS ANGELES — Fun Factory USA has announced the addition of Michael Cox as the new senior sales manager.

He brings with him years of industry experience, having previously worked at Total Access Group (an extension of ID Lubricants) and Oxballs.

Cox earned his M.B.A. at California Baptist University. From there, he accepted a position in the public health sector for Total Access Group. During his time there, he worked with various health clinics such as Planned Parenthood and clinics at colleges and universities, selling condoms and lube to ensure the practices of safe sex.

He also secured a state contract promising $1.5 million in business over three years. In 2017, he moved to Oxballs, where he was responsible for managing and developing 100-plus accounts globally.

“I am extremely excited to start this new chapter and to bring my expertise and knowledge to Fun Factory,” Cox said. “Although Oxballs focused heavily on men’s products, I am confident my transition to Fun Factory will be successful, as both companies have great stories to tell. A company with a long and innovative history, high-quality products, and a unique story — I can sell that!”

Frederic Walme, Fun Factory’s CEO, added, “Michael not only brings his years of experience and success in both more mainstream and more specialized areas of our unique industry. His warmth, humor and enthusiasm make him a perfect addition to our Fun Factory sales team.”
